Technological Advancements:

Domestic CNC lathes have made significant strides in technological advancements, closing the gap with their foreign counterparts. However, foreign CNC lathes often boast cutting-edge innovations, such as advanced tooling systems, precision control mechanisms, and integrated software solutions. Understanding the evolving technology is paramount for manufacturers seeking to optimize their machining processes.

Cost Considerations:

One of the primary factors influencing the choice between domestic and foreign CNC lathes is the cost. While domestic machines may offer cost advantages in terms of initial investment and maintenance, foreign machines might provide better long-term value with higher efficiency, precision, and reduced downtime. Striking a balance between upfront costs and long-term benefits is crucial for manufacturers.

Quality and Precision:

The precision and quality of CNC-machined parts play a pivotal role in manufacturing success. Foreign CNC lathes are often renowned for their superior precision and quality output. Domestic machines, however, have been narrowing this gap by adopting stringent quality control measures and investing in research and development. Analyzing the specific requirements of a manufacturing process is essential in determining which machine aligns better with the desired quality standards.

Customization and Adaptability:

The ability to adapt to diverse manufacturing needs is a critical consideration. Foreign CNC lathes are often designed to accommodate a wide range of materials and specifications. Domestic machines are catching up by offering increased customization options, but understanding the specific requirements of a production line is vital for choosing the right machine that can seamlessly adapt to evolving demands.

Supply Chain and Support Services:

A robust supply chain and comprehensive support services are essential for minimizing downtime and ensuring the smooth operation of CNC lathes. Foreign manufacturers often provide extensive support networks, but domestic suppliers may offer advantages in terms of proximity and faster response times. Evaluating the support infrastructure is crucial for minimizing the impact of unexpected issues.
